Description

The Audio-Technica AT2022 Stereo Condenser Microphone is your passport to capturing the essence of live sound with precision and clarity. Perfect for both studio and field recording, this microphone is crafted to deliver an authentic stereo experience. Its dual unidirectional condenser capsules are arranged in an X/Y configuration, giving you the flexibility to switch between a narrow 90º and a wide 120º stereo field. This versatility ensures you can adapt to any recording environment, from intimate acoustic sessions to expansive outdoor soundscapes.

Designed with portability in mind, the AT2022's capsules fold flat, making it easy to store and transport without compromising on durability. Whether you're a professional musician, a podcaster, or an audio enthusiast, this microphone offers the spatial impact needed to reproduce the realism of a live sound field.

The AT2022 comes equipped with essential accessories that enhance its usability right out of the box. A stand clamp ensures stability during recording sessions, while the included AA battery powers the microphone for extended use. The fuzzy windscreen minimizes unwanted noise, making it ideal for outdoor recording, and the 0.5 m cable with a 3.5 mm stereo plug ensures seamless connectivity to your recording devices.

FAQs

What is the polar pattern of the Audio-Technica AT2022 microphone?

The Audio-Technica AT2022 features a bidirectional polar pattern, utilizing two unidirectional condenser capsules in an X/Y configuration for stereo recording. This setup allows for user-selectable 90° or 120° stereo operation.

Can the Audio-Technica AT2022 be used for field recording?

Yes, the AT2022 is ideal for field recording due to its battery operation, which allows it to be used with most recording devices, and its included fuzzy windscreen that offers excellent wind protection.

How does the AT2022 handle low-frequency noise?

The AT2022 includes a switchable low-frequency roll-off feature that minimizes the pickup of unwanted low-frequency noise, making it suitable for capturing clear audio in various environments.

Is the Audio-Technica AT2022 suitable for stereo recording?

Yes, the AT2022 is specifically designed for stereo recording, providing excellent channel separation and the spatial impact and realism of a live sound field.

What power source does the Audio-Technica AT2022 require?

The AT2022 operates on battery power, making it compatible with most recording devices and ideal for portable use.

Features and functionality

  • The AT2022 can operate with "plug-in power," a lower voltage alternative to XLR phantom power, making it compatible with devices lacking full phantom power.

    Source
  • The AT2022 is equipped with a 1/8" stereo plug, making it adaptable for various setups with additional adapters like gender benders to convert to XLR inputs.

    Source
  • The lightweight construction of the AT2022 makes it preferable for handheld recording situations, reducing fatigue during extended use.

    Source

Critic Reviews

Audio-Technica AT2022 X/Y Stereo Microphone Review - Videomaker

videomaker.com

The Audio-Technica AT2022 Stereo Condenser Microphone delivers impressive audio quality at a budget-friendly price. Its robust build and adjustable pickup patterns make it versatile for both studio and field use. However, caution is needed with the unbalanced output and the delicate shock mounts, which can be easily damaged if not handled properly. Additionally, while it excels at capturing louder sounds, it struggles with quieter ones and can pick up wind noise without a windscreen. Overall, it's a solid choice for those seeking quality stereo recording without breaking the bank.
